When searching for an oven on sale, particular features can substantially impact your cooking experience. Buyers ought to prioritize the following:
Size: Ensure the oven fits your kitchen space. Step the area where the oven will be set up before buying.
Fuel Type: Decide in between gas and electric. Gas ovens provide accurate temperature control, while electric ovens tend to be more consistent in baking.
Self-Cleaning: Self-cleaning ovens conserve time and effort in maintaining tidiness, an essential feature for hectic households.
Smart Features: Modern ovens might include Wi-Fi connectivity, enabling you to manage your oven remotely, adjust settings, and get notifications.
Temperature Range: Consider the flexibility of temperature settings. High-end designs frequently offer a larger series of temperatures for numerous cooking designs.
Additional Cooking Modes: Some ovens include specialized modes like steam, broil, and air fry, supplying adaptability in cooking approaches.

How do I understand if the oven is energy-efficient?
Energy Star-rated ovens typically signify better energy performance. Check for the Energy Guide label on the appliance, which offers yearly energy consumption information.
